How they compare
Saint Lucia currently reports 5.6 per 1,000 against 5.4 per 1,000 in Belize, a difference of 0.2 per 1,000.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Saint Lucia ahead.
Belize ranks 48th and Saint Lucia ranks 47th of 197 countries.
Belize has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belize | Saint Lucia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 4.84 per 1,000 | 3.81 per 1,000 | 1.03 per 1,000 | Belize |
| 2000s | 6.55 per 1,000 | 3.53 per 1,000 | 3.02 per 1,000 | Belize |
| 2010s | 6.11 per 1,000 | 3.44 per 1,000 | 2.67 per 1,000 | Belize |
| 2020s | 5.34 per 1,000 | 4.94 per 1,000 | 0.4 per 1,000 | Belize |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Probability of dying between age 15-19 years of age expressed per 1,000 adolescents age 15, if subject to age-specific mortality rates of the specified year.
